    I rarely create new threads, but my family and I saw this movie over the past weekend and it was as big a blast as I've had in the movie theater in a while. It's a ridiculous Christmas movie in which Santa Claus (who is real) gets caught up in a hostage situation on Christmas eve and has to go full action movie hero to save the family. It is gloriously violent and funny. There were a few sequences that had me laughing as hard as I have in what feels like forever. It's done reasonably well in two weekends at the box office considering its low budget, but I wanted to encourage everyone to go see it because this is the kind of fun Hollywood movie that I wish got made more often.
